Ardipithecus
One of the earliest genera of bipeds that lived in eastern Africa. Ardipithecus is actually divided into two species, the older of which dates to between 5.2 and 5.8 million years ago, and the younger, A. ramidus, dated to around 4.4 million years ago.
Spinal Column
The flexible longitudinal column made of a series of bones called vertebrae, which houses the spinal cord and provides structural support to the body.

Chimpanzee
A species of great ape native to the forests and savannahs of tropical Africa, known for their complex social structures and behaviors.
